I have a question and need help. I have had a red tail for over a year. I want to adopt a Boa my friend is selling. I want to know if it is a good ar bad idea placing both boas in the same cage. will the fight? Will they get upset and not eat? The cage I have is about 4 feet long 1 1/2 wide and 1 1/2 tall. My boa is 3 feet long and the boa I want to introduce is also 3 feet long. Any info is greatly appreciated.
It is best to keep them separate. If you do a search on this topic, there have been many great posts discussing this issue.

Quarantine isnt a opition? What happens if one gets sick due to the other? I strongly advise a quarantine time. Its not very hard to do. Keep them in 2 different rooms and use different equipment for each snake for 60-90 days. Best of Luck.
